@article{oai:aue.repo.nii.ac.jp:00002243, author = {Miyakawa, Hidetoshi and Asakawa, Masaki and Tsuzuki, Chie}, journal = {愛知教育大学教育実践総合センター紀要}, month = {Mar}, note = {text, The present study examines the problems that occur to the students and their concrete solutions in Technology Education to clarify how students' learning styles would affect their problem solving behaviors. After the class of "Machines" area was taught to the third year students at a junior high school, both the problems that occurred to them and the specific solutions were studied according to the students' learning styles. As a result, it is found that students with each learning style shows the differences in the specific solutions they took. The students with "Versatile and Deep Holist Type" applied solutions of "Enhancing awareness" more than the students with other two types as it was shown in the units of "Leg Production" and "Modification". On the other hand, the students with "Deep Serialist Type" were found that they didn't utilize solutions of "Modeling" as much as other students with other two types. This finding confirms that the "Deep Serialist Type" students have field-independent characteristic.}, pages = {171--179}, title = {Learning Style and Problem Solving in Technology Education (II)}, volume = {6}, year = {2003} }
